Natural fillers. Pros and cons

Residents of megacities and rural areas, seeking to get away from synthetic abundance and wanting to surround themselves with environmentally friendly objects, prefer natural materials. They use filler for pear chairs in different combinations

  1. Wood shavings. It is advantageous to use coniferous shavings (cedar, pine), which exudes healing aromas and does not allow rodent pests to approach. But the material requires careful selection and over time it turns into small filings that lose their appearance and do not give volume.
  2. Fluff mixed with feather. The material is light, but stray over time. Fluff is used with extreme caution, because it most often causes allergic reactions. And when wet, such a filler exudes a peculiar smell that not everyone will like.
  3. Cereals and legumes are rice, peas, beans and even peanuts. But such products differ in weight and are prone to invasion by rodents, who are not averse to feasting on the contents of frameless furniture.

The disadvantage of natural materials is their hygroscopicity. By attracting moisture, such a filler for pear chairs can sprout, mold, acquire a musty smell. In the conditions of country houses or irregularly heated rooms, it is better to abandon the venture with such materials.

Filler for a pear chair - expanded polystyrene

The most popular for the manufacture of frameless furniture are synthetic balls that create the required volume. A product filled with crushed polystyrene does not lose its shape during operation for a long time. Expanded polystyrene granules are lightweight foam elastic air lumps. Products where the filler for pear chairs easily takes the desired shape, transforming into the shape of a person, has appealed to modern users. Such furniture provides a person with an orthopedic effect. Allowing the body to relax, a high-quality filler does not allow the wearer to fall awkwardly into the chair, but has the effect of a cloud that hugs the figure, giving it a comfortable position.

Synthetic Filler Benefits

The buyer makes his choice on the artificial material for stuffing the pouffe bag because of the advantages of expanded polystyrene, due to which frameless furniture retains its shape for a long time. What attracts them to this material?

  1. Environmental safety of granules that do not emit toxic substances.
  2. It has excellent thermal preservation properties.
  3. Lightness, because a voluminous product is easily moved by a child.
  4. Fire resistant.
  5. It does not absorb sweat, moisture and dirt, so the humidity of the room is not afraid of him.
  6. Unattractive to rodents and parasites.
  7. Not subject to destruction, and slight shrinkage is easily replaced.

How much filler is needed for a pear chair

It is not difficult for the puff owner to supplement the volume of foam polystyrene foam foam that has decreased independently with time . On sale expanded polystyrene balls are sold in packages of 100 liters.

But for buyers who decide to make original furniture on their own, using filler for a pear chair. 300 liters is the minimum amount needed. You only need to follow the safety rules when stuffing the product, because light granules can get into the respiratory tract when pouring. Scattered balls can be removed with a vacuum cleaner.
